#1b23e6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b23e6 is composed of 10.6% red, 13.7%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.3% cyan, 84.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 237.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 50.4%. #1b23e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#3646ff with #0000cd.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#1b23e6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b23e6 has RGB values of R:27, G:35, B:230 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 1778662.

Shades and Tints of #1b23e6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#eff0fd is the lightest one.
